Block Inc saw its stock (XYZ) surge as much as 18% in the last 24 hours after CEO Jack Dorsey announced mass layoffs at the company. The parent company of Square and Cash App said Thursday that it plans to lay off 40% of its workforce, or more than 4,000 employees.
“The core thesis is simple,” wrote Dorsey. “Intelligence tools have changed what it means to build and run a company.” During the company’s earnings call, the CEO also said “something happened in December of last year” when he realized how capable and intelligent AI models had become. “If there are any gaps in our usage of AI right now, it’s an application gap,” he said.

Those AI-focused fears have already become a reality at other companies, not just Block. Salesforce (CRM) cut roughly 4,000 customer-support roles last year because of AI advancements. Pinterest, meanwhile, has said it is laying off nearly 15% of its workforce as part of a plan to focus more of the company’s resources on AI-related roles. As for Block’s financials, its valuation metrics have significantly improved, with the P/E ratio dropping from 117.06x in Q3 2025 to 30.29x in Q4 2025, indicating a more attractive valuation for investors. However, growth metrics reveal a concerning trend, as earnings growth plummeted by 53.95% in Q4 2025, while revenue growth has stagnated at 0.30%. Profitability is on the rise, with gross margins improving to 42.82% and operating margins reaching 7.06%, suggesting enhanced operational efficiency.
